About the Role
We are looking for an organised and proactive Fleet & Logistics Administrator in Accrington. This is a varied role supporting multiple areas of the business, including fleet management, plant administration, logistics, purchasing, and general office administration. If you thrive in a fast-paced environment and enjoy multitasking, this could be the perfect opportunity for you.

Key Responsibilities

  • Maintain and update vehicle records and fleet tracking systems
  • Manage fuel card administration
  • Oversee MOT and service records
  • Liaise with garages for bookings and repairs
  • Process vehicle check returns
Mill/Plant Administration
  • Schedule services, appointments, and breakdowns
  • Update systems including Trackunit and Asset Panda
  • Maintain stock records
Logistics Support
  • Manage calendars and job sheets
Purchasing Administration
  • Raise purchase orders on Eque
  • Handle petty cash
  • Procure and distribute PPE, workwear, first aid, welfare, and stationery
  • Maintain external hire records and cross-check with sites
Supply Chain Administration
  • Assess and file PQQs
  • Chase insurances and compliance documents
  • Liaise with internal teams to complete forms and update systems
  • Link spreadsheets with Eque and Evaluate
Aftersales Support
  • Log defects and manage email administration
  • Arrange site visits
General Office Support
  • Timesheet checking and travel time administration
  • Provide accounts and admin support during peak periods and holiday cover
